  • Footage taken in September 2021. My rig is a 2006 Lexus GX470. It has a 3” coil lift that includes Vated suspension from Fat Bobs, Eibach coils up front, OME coils in the rear, and SPC UCA’s. Wheels are the factory TRD Pro 4Runner wheels and tires are BF Goodrich 285/70R17 (~33”).
